    Rosie *purr purr*

    This poem is dedicated to Rosie, who passed away recently. It doesn't have any strict form, but hey, that's life.

    Rosie purr purr

    “Ooh, look! She’s so pretty!”
    purr purr
    “She has huge ears”
    purr purr
    “When are we moving, Mummy?”
    purr purr

    “She’s been here how long?!”
    purr purr
    “Look, she found the Blue Blanket”
    purr purr
    “Do you think she will ever be friends with the new kitten?”
    purr purr
    “When are we moving Mummy?”
    purr purr

    “Mu-um, I’m going out with some friends, I’ll be back by 6:30”
    purr purr
    “What a movie!”
    purr purr
    “The house looks great now, doesn’t it Rosie?”
    purr purr
    “I wonder how she’ll handle the puppy…”
    purr purr
    “Well, it’s about time you two got married!”
    purr purr
    “That Chook beats up all the cats, except her.”
    purr purr
    “Hey, Mum, I got the dates for University, I have to move in February.”
    purr purr

    “I miss my pets…”
    … ….
    “I’m coming home for the weekend.”
    purr purr
    “Wow. She has put on weight.”
    purr purr
    “I’ll be back at uni on Sunday.”
    purr purr
    “I miss my pets…”
    … …

    “She didn’t get up”
    … …
    … …
    “I miss Rosie”
    Somewhere, purr purr

    Dedicated to Rosie, who was always there,
    providing the soundtrack for my life
    purr purr
